Caribbean Airlines 24-Hour Cancellation Policy

Under the Caribbean Airlines 24-Hour Cancellation Policy, passengers who book directly with the airline can cancel within 24 hours of purchase without penalty, provided the flight departs at least seven days later. This rule aligns with international consumer protection standards and offers a critical safety net for quick booking errors or schedule reconsiderations.

This policy applies regardless of fare type, making it one of the most valuable consumer-friendly provisions in Caribbean Airlines’ framework.

Caribbean Airlines Refund Process & Time

The Caribbean Airlines Refund Process & Time depends on payment method and fare eligibility:

  • Credit/Debit Cards: 7–21 business days

  • Cash or Check: Longer processing timelines

  • Travel Credits: Issued faster, often within days

Refund delays are most commonly caused by incomplete passenger details or third-party bookings.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Can I cancel my Caribbean Airlines flight for free?

Free cancellation is possible within 24 hours of booking if your flight departs at least seven days later. Beyond that window, free cancellation depends on whether you purchased a flexible or business fare. Promotional and standard economy fares typically incur fees or limited refunds.

2. What happens if I cancel after the 24-hour window?

After 24 hours, cancellation fees and refund eligibility depend on your fare type. Flexible fares usually allow refunds with minimal penalties, while promotional fares may offer only partial credits or no refund at all, excluding refundable taxes.

3. How long does it take to receive a refund from Caribbean Airlines?

Refunds to credit or debit cards usually take between 7 and 21 business days. Processing times can vary depending on banking institutions, fare rules, and whether the booking was made directly or through a third-party agency.

4. Can I still get a refund if I bought a non-refundable ticket?

Non-refundable tickets generally do not qualify for base fare refunds. However, certain government taxes may still be refunded. In some cases, Caribbean Airlines may offer travel credits instead of cash refunds.

5. Do cancellation fees vary by fare class?

Yes. Cancellation fees are closely tied to fare class. Promotional fares carry the highest restrictions, standard fares have moderate fees, and flexible or business fares offer the lowest or zero cancellation penalties.

6. What if Caribbean Airlines cancels my flight?

If the airline cancels your flight, you are entitled to a full refund or free rebooking. In some cases, additional care such as meals or accommodation may be provided, depending on the circumstances and delay duration.

7. Can I cancel part of a multi-city booking?

Partial cancellations are possible but may reprice the remaining itinerary. This can increase costs or affect refund eligibility. Reviewing fare conditions before canceling one segment is strongly recommended.

8. How do I request a cancellation or refund?

You can request a cancellation through the “Manage My Booking” section on the airline’s website or by contacting customer service. Third-party bookings must usually be handled through the original seller.

9. Are travel credits offered instead of cash refunds?

Yes. When cash refunds are restricted, Caribbean Airlines may issue travel credits. These credits typically have expiration dates and usage conditions, which should be reviewed carefully before acceptance.

10. Can exceptional circumstances waive cancellation fees?

In certain cases—such as medical emergencies or government travel restrictions—Caribbean Airlines may consider waiving fees. Documentation is usually required, and approval is handled on a case-by-case basis.
